Mr. and Mrs. Robin's Family (Revised) Trailer

Mr. and Mrs. Robin's Family (Revised) Trailer (1978)

01 January 1978 Factual 10 mins

A child narrates this story of a robin family from early spring to late fall. Beautiful nature photography shows the fledglings born and growing up, the robins' daily habits and seasonal activities.
